单播、多播和任播是什么意思?底层原理是什么? [ 新手入门 ]
单播、多播和任播是IPv6网络中的三种不同的数据传输方式。
单播(Unicast)指的是从一个发送者向一个接收者发送数据的传输方式。在单播传输中,数据包只能被一个目标设备接收。
多播(Multicast)指的是从一个发送者向多个接收者发送数据的传输方式。在多播传输中,数据包可以被多个目标设备接收。
任播(Anycast)指的是从一个发送者向多个接收者中的一个发送数据的传输方式。在任播传输中,数据包只会被距离发送者最近的一个目标设备接收。
底层原理是IPv6网络协议栈中的路由选择算法。在单播传输中,路由选择算法会根据目标地址选择一条最优路径,将数据包发送到目标设备。在多播传输中,路由选择算法会根据多播地址选择一条能够到达所有目标设备的路径,将数据包发送到多个目标设备。在任播传输中,路由选择算法会根据任播地址选择一条距离最近的路径,将数据包发送到距离发送者最近的目标设备。通过这些不同的传输方式,IPv6网络可以更加高效地传输数据,满足不同的应用需求。
共 0 条回复
没有找到数据。
PHP学院的中学生
注册时间:2018-10-23
最后登录:2024-09-23
在线时长:168小时13分
最后登录:2024-09-23
在线时长:168小时13分
- 粉丝29
- 金钱4725
- 威望30
- 积分6705